The Rising Threat of Turbulence

Recent data reveals a concerning trend: turbulence is increasing in severity and frequency globally. While various factors contribute to turbulence, including weather patterns and atmospheric conditions, scientists have observed a clear upward trajectory in its intensity over the past few decades. This rise poses a significant challenge for airlines and passengers alike, demanding heightened awareness and preparedness.

The impact of this trend is multifaceted. Airlines face operational complexities, as pilots must navigate increasingly unpredictable air currents. Passengers, on the other hand, experience discomfort and, in severe cases, potential injuries due to sudden jolts and vibrations. The increasing severity and unpredictability of turbulence necessitate a proactive approach to mitigate risks and ensure safe travel.

Understanding Turbulence Types

Turbulence manifests in various forms, each with distinct characteristics and causes. Mountain wave turbulence occurs when wind encounters mountainous terrain, generating upward air currents that cause bumpy rides. Convective turbulence, often associated with thunderstorms, arises from the rapid ascent of warm air. Clear air turbulence, the most enigmatic and potentially hazardous type, can occur in seemingly calm skies due to complex atmospheric interactions.

Clear air turbulence presents a particular challenge because it is harder to predict and detect visually. While pilots utilize advanced weather forecasting tools and onboard sensors to identify potential turbulence zones, clear air turbulence often develops rapidly and without warning. This unpredictability underscores the importance of adhering to safety guidelines and remaining vigilant throughout the flight.

Buckle Seatbelt, Avoid Storms, Early Flight

When it comes to mitigating risks associated with turbulence, several preventive measures can significantly enhance passenger safety. The most crucial step is always to keep your seatbelt fastened securely while seated, regardless of the type or intensity of turbulence.

Additionally, staying informed about weather patterns and flight routes can help minimize exposure to turbulent conditions. Airlines often provide updates on expected turbulence levels, allowing passengers to make informed decisions about their travel plans. Choosing flights that depart early in the day can also be advantageous, as convective turbulence tends to peak in the late afternoon.
